Kansas Town's Green Dreams Could Save Its Futureby (author unknown), NPR Topics: Environment on Dec 27, 2008After a tornado nearly destroyed Greensburg, Kan., in May, city leaders came up with a revival plan: make it the greenest town in America. Among the projects are new homes and buildings that are more efficient than the ones they replaced.
